Abstract

The utility model provides a sterilization aerator for aquaculture capable of efficiently improving the dissolved oxygen degree of a water body, which comprises an air inlet pipe arranged under a water surface and a pressure submersible pump with a water inlet and a water outlet and further comprises a water inlet pipe for simultaneously intaking water from the opposite direction, a water outlet pipe for simultaneously discharging the water from the opposite direction and at least a nanometer magnetic sterilization aerator arranged on the water outlet pipe and used for filtering the water body; the air inlet pipe is connected with the pressure submersible pump through the water inlet pipe; and the pressure submersible pump is connected with the water outlet pipe. The utility model can ensure that aquatic products living under the water have enough oxygen to survive and the damage of harmful bacteria in the water caused to the aquatic products is reduced, thereby improving the output and the quality of the aquatic products.

Description

Submersible type nanometer magnetization bactericidal oxygenation machine
Technical field
The utility model relates to a kind of oxygen-increasing device, specifically refers to the used for aquiculture bactericidal oxygenation machine that improves the water body oxygen dissolved.
Background technology
In aquaculture field, the output of aquatic products is usually disturbed for a long time because of the problems such as own quality that the noxious bacteria of weather effect and aquatic products exceeds standard.Live in that water-bed aquatic products are low in Changes in weather, air pressure, oxygen dissolved can greatly reduce during dissolved oxygen in water degree step-down, thereby influence the aquatic products healthy growth, cause the reduction of the output and the quality of aquatic products.How to improve the existence oxygen in the water and reduce noxious bacteria in the water? based on this point, existing used for aquiculture aerator only is to carry out oxygenation at water surface, rather than at water middle part or the degree of depth oxygenation of bottom, its immersible pump is put on the water surface, heat radiation is slow, and the sun in summer direct projection can not long-time continuous be used, limited to round-the-clock, the comprehensive performance of oxygen-increasing device, and common aerator is not murdered the function of noxious bacteria yet.
Summary of the invention
For overcoming the deficiencies in the prior art, the utility model proposes a kind of oxygen dissolved that improves water middle part and bottom, increase oxygen and supply with, and kill the submersible type nanometer magnetization bactericidal oxygenation machine of noxious bacteria in the water by continuous circulation energy large tracts of land fast.
For achieving the above object, the utility model is achieved by the following technical programs: this submersible type nanometer magnetization bactericidal oxygenation machine has and is located at the following air intake duct of the water surface and has water inlet and the pressurization immersible pump of delivery port, also have the water inlet pipe that rightabout intakes simultaneously, the outlet pipe of rightabout water outlet simultaneously, be located on the outlet pipe to filter at least one nanometer magnetization bactericidal oxygenation device of water body, described air intake duct joins by described water inlet pipe and pressurization immersible pump, and the pressurization immersible pump is connected with outlet pipe.
In above-mentioned, water inlet pipe has the last water inlet and following water inlet or left water inlet and right water inlet that rightabout is intake simultaneously.
Described outlet pipe has left delivery port and right delivery port or the upper water-out mouth and the lower outlet of rightabout water outlet simultaneously.
The left and right delivery port place of described outlet pipe or upper and lower delivery port place are provided with nanometer magnetization bactericidal oxygenation device respectively.
Described pressurization immersible pump, nanometer magnetization bactericidal oxygenation device are located at water middle part or water-bed portion.
Compared with prior art, the utlity model has following substantive distinguishing features and progress: the oxygen dissolved that can fast and effeciently improve water middle part and bottom, assurance lives in that water-bed aquatic products are low in Changes in weather, air pressure, increase oxygen dissolved during dissolved oxygen in water degree step-down, enough oxygen existence is arranged and reduce noxious bacteria in the water, make aquatic products energy healthy growth, guarantee output, improve the quality, solved in the aquaculture output and be subjected to the excessive and quality of aquatic products of weather effect own as problems such as harmful bacterium exceed standard.
Description of drawings
The utility model is described in further detail below in conjunction with drawings and Examples.
Fig. 1 is a structural representation of the present utility model.
Among the figure: 1, air intake duct, 2, immersible pump, 3, water inlet pipe, 301, go up water inlet, 302, water inlet down, 4, outlet pipe, 401, left delivery port, 402, right delivery port, 5, nanometer magnetization bactericidal oxygenation device.
Embodiment
With reference to shown in Figure 1, the utility model submersible type nanometer magnetization bactericidal oxygenation machine is located at water middle part or water-bed portion, this device is by air intake duct 1, bring the immersible pump 2 of the mouth of a river and delivery port into, the water inlet pipe 3 that rightabout is intake simultaneously, the outlet pipe 4 of rightabout water outlet simultaneously constitutes, immersible pump can be fixed on the underwater with plastic cement PPR water wing or telescope support, water inlet pipe 3 has the last water inlet 301 and following water inlet 302 that rightabout is intake simultaneously, outlet pipe 4 has the left delivery port 401 and right delivery port 402 of rightabout water outlet simultaneously, left side at outlet pipe 4, right delivery port place is provided with a nanometer magnetization bactericidal oxygenation device 5 separately, with doing that water body is filtered also sterilization, this nanometer magnetization bactericidal oxygenation device 5 places dried up following 1.2M place.Air intake duct 1 wherein joins by water inlet pipe 3 and immersible pump 2, and immersible pump 2 is connected with outlet pipe 4.
Operating principle of the present utility model and using method are as follows: immersible pump is plugged in, oxygen enters water inlet pipe 3 by air intake duct 1, water in water inlet pipe 3 enters immersible pump 2, after pressurization, enter outlet pipe 4 and magnetize bactericidal oxygenation device 5 and filter and sterilizations through the nanometer at mouth of pipe place, the outlet pipe left and right sides, the water body oxygen dissolved of dried up the easy anoxic below 1.1 meters is increased, noxious bacteria reduces, aquatic products growth preferably.
This device is by increasing the oxygen dissolved of water middle part and bottom fast, and constantly large tracts of land is killed noxious bacteria in the water fast circularly, and immersible pump is arranged on water middle part or water-bed portion, and rapid heat dissipation can use continuously for a long time.In addition, rightabout Inlet and outlet water is simultaneously all adopted in water inlet of this device and water outlet, forms hydraulic balance, thereby greatly reduces the vibration of immersible pump, and the delivery port water column has lift, can promote water body and flow, and makes stagnant water become running water, more helps the growth of aquatic products.
